Rubie Flops Wheel...But Chops

Timothy Adams raised to 60,000 on the button and Brendon Rubie called from the big blind.

The flop came down {A-Clubs}{3-Spades}{2-Clubs} and Rubie checked. Adams bet 30,000, but Rubie put in a raise to 90,000. Adams called to see the {4-Diamonds} turn. Rubie bet 130,000, but was met with a raise to 265,000 from Adams. Rubie called, though, and moved all in when the {5-Spades} river fell. Adams took a few moments before he called.

Rubie: {5-Hearts}{4-Hearts}
Adams: {A-Diamonds}{4-Clubs}

Both players played the board with the wheel to chop the pot.
